Wurth #8 x 1-5/8 inch flat head assembly screw describes a case hardened screw sized for joining wood components in assembly work. The #8 diameter and 1-5/8 inch length give a familiar format for fastening common cabinet or woodworking parts where this length is appropriate. The flat head layout lets the screw sit flush to the surface after driving, helping parts draw tight without a raised head interfering with adjacent components or hardware. The square drive system works with #2 square drive bits, giving a positive bit engagement that helps transfer torque into the screw during installation. This reduces cam-out during driving and supports more controlled installation in production or jobsite settings where repeat fastening is required.
The product data notes that 3/4 inch and 1 inch lengths in this series are threaded fully, while all other sizes are threaded two-thirds from the bottom of the screw, so a buyer can expect this 1-5/8 inch size to follow the two-thirds thread pattern that draws parts together while allowing an unthreaded shank near the head. The screw uses #2 square drive bits, giving a defined driver size that installers can match to their tooling for productive work on benches or in the field. The combination of coarse thread and Type 17 auger point supports drilling and pulling action in wood-based materials, so the screw advances efficiently once driving begins.

The square drive design, working with #2 square drive bits, allows the bit to seat firmly into the recess, so torque transfer stays direct and supported as the screw turns into the workpiece. This reduces tendency for the bit to slip out under load, which helps maintain the recess shape and supports straightforward re-driving if a component must be adjusted and reset. For installers running multiple screws into similar material, this positive engagement assists in maintaining a steady pace without interrupting to address stripped heads.
The coarse thread pattern means each rotation advances the screw more aggressively into the substrate, so fewer turns are needed to bring components tight. In wood assembly, this aids in pulling parts together with less driving time per screw. The two-thirds-from-bottom thread layout on lengths over 1 inch, which this size follows, leaves a portion of unthreaded shank near the head, so the threaded section focuses its grip in the base material while the unthreaded section lets the top member slide, promoting clamping between pieces.
